The UEFI shim installs wrappers around several boot services functions before invoking its next stage bootloader, in an attempt to enforce its desired behaviour upon the aforementioned bootloader. For example, shim checks that the bootloader has either invoked StartImage() or has called into the "shim lock protocol" before allowing an ExitBootServices() call to proceed. When invoking a shim, iPXE will also install boot services function wrappers in order to work around assorted bugs in the UEFI shim code that would otherwise prevent it from being used to boot a kernel.
